Mergers & Acquisitions MYTecSoft, Opel Systems tie up Our Bureau Hyderabad, Feb. 2 IT services provider MYTecSoft and Michigan-based Opel Systems have announced merger of the two companies, which will have combined revenues of $11 million by this fiscal end. Addressing a press conference, the founder of MYTecSoft, Mr Ram Reddy, said the new entity is in the process of setting up of a development centre in Vizag spread over a 2.5-acre site. This centre, to be operational by the year-end, would have capacity to host around 500 people. Both the companies are engaged in providing enterprise software solutions across different verticals.
